Navratri Yoga Tips: Suffering from Constipation During Fasting? These Yoga Poses Can Help
Simple Asanas to Keep Your Digestion Healthy During Navratri

Navratri Yoga Tips: During the Navratri fast, changes in diet often lead to digestive issues like constipation. Including yoga in your daily routine can help prevent this problem. Along with yoga, make sure to drink sufficient water, consume coconut water, and eat fiber-rich fruits. A combination of yoga and a balanced fasting diet makes your fast not only spiritually fulfilling but also physically healthy. Here are some effective yoga poses that can help those observing the fast.
Pavanamuktasana (Wind-Relieving Pose)
This pose provides relief from gas and constipation. It helps release trapped gas and improves bowel movement.
Lie flat on your back, bend your knees, and hug them close to your chest with both hands. Inhale and exhale deeply while holding the position. This asana massages the intestines and makes bowel movements easier and more natural.
Ardha Matsyendrasana (Half Spinal Twist Pose)
This twisting pose activates the digestive system and boosts metabolism.
Sit on the floor with one leg extended straight. Bend the other leg and place it outside the opposite knee. Twist your upper body and hold the bent knee with the opposite hand. This asana enhances digestion, reduces constipation and acidity, and stimulates abdominal organs.
Paschimottanasana (Seated Forward Bend)
Sit with your legs stretched out straight. Extend your arms forward to hold your toes and try to bring your head toward your knees.
This pose stimulates the intestines and helps relieve constipation. It also reduces fatigue and sluggishness that can occur during fasting.
Bhujangasana (Cobra Pose)
Bhujangasana strengthens the abdominal muscles and improves blood circulation in the intestines.
Lie on your stomach and lift your chest upward using your hands while controlling your breathing. This pose helps relieve constipation, gas, and indigestion.
Vajrasana (Thunderbolt Pose)
This is the only yoga pose that can be performed immediately after eating.
During fasting, whenever you consume fruits or light meals, sit in Vajrasana for a few minutes afterward. It improves digestion and reduces the chances of constipation.
